The Tucumcari Historical Museum is dedicated to preserving and showcasing the rich heritage of Tucumcari, New Mexico. It serves as an educational resource for residents and visitors alike, offering insights into the area's history and culture.

Additionally, the museum plays an integral role in the community by participating in local events and collaborating with organizations such as the Tucumcari Chamber of Commerce and Tucumcari Mainstreet. Through these partnerships, it aims to foster community engagement and celebrate the unique stories of Tucumcari.
